The summer months are a busy time for our school staff. This summer, school buildings were cleaned thoroughly; repairs, improvements, and minor construction projects were completed in school buildings; new employees were hired; and educators and other employees participated in professional learning and planning for the school year. Several of our educators participated in our summer school program with a range of offerings to K-12 students to both strengthen and enhance academic skills.

Our back-to-school theme this year is Proud History, Bright Future . We are finalizing our annual district goals and will communicate those in the upcoming weeks. As we welcome the new school year, Whitnall School District will continue our focus on:
  • Student achievement and readiness
  • Effective communication
  • Responsive fiscal planning and management
  • District culture and climate

Whitnall Middle School
WMS First Day of School: 6th Graders Only!

We will spend the first day of the new school year (Sept. 1st) getting our 6th graders acclimated and familiar with the building. 7th and 8th graders will not report until Tuesday, Sept. 5th.

Back to School Night

Join us at EES to meet your child’s teacher, drop off supplies, and enjoy some ice cream with the EES PTO. Back to School Night is scheduled for Wednesday, August 30th. 


   4:30 - 5:30 pm New Family Orientation in main gym
   5:30 - 6:30 pm Classroom Visits
   6:00 - 7:00 pm Edgerton PTO Ice Cream Social in main gym
